LaCie d2: now with Serial ATA

SATA interface that is getting more and more popular has reached LaCie solutions in d2 Serial ATA with 74 GB (10,000 rpm) to 400 GB (7200 rpm) capacities.


The new storage devices as well as LaCie SATA PCI Card are to go on sale in January with the following prices in Europe:

  • 74 GB, 10,000 rpm — ˆ340
  • 160 GB, 7,200 rpm — ˆ190
  • 250 GB, 7,200 rpm — ˆ230
  • 400 GB, 7,200 rpm — ˆ460

Drives will be bundled with LaCie Storage Utilities and SilverKeeper software. New devices can also be mounted into 19" server racks.

The secret of MSI K8N Diamond

And again we took a look at another NVIDIA nForce 4 SLI based motherboard. But such cool feature as SLI is now pushed aside, because K8N Diamond from Micro-Star International might shatter some desktop audio market stereotypes.

Our colleagues from t-break published these interesting photos of this board. At that the photographer was impressed not by a couple of PCI Express x16, but a large chip in the bottom left corner:


Is it really "CREATIVE"? Let´s take a closer look:


Yes, it is. The chip is marked CREATIVE CA0106-DAT. It´s the same DSP chip as those used in Creative Audigy LS and Live! 24bit soundcards. To the left of CA0106-DAT you can see Wolfson WM8775 ADC, further to the left there´s Cirrus Logic sign — a DAC, most likely. Perhaps, MSI didn´t try to invent a wheel again, but kept to the reference design of Audigy LS/Live! 24bit. Still, higher-quality electrolytic capacitor might improve the sound path a bit.

We asked ourselves if it´s not another Photoshop joke. After visiting the official website of MSI we found photos and specs of K8N Diamond.


On the same place onboard you can see a large chip with a big sticker on it. Looking into the specs we found what we needed:


Well, there´s a strange trend outlining: Creative starts shipping its DSP chips to third parties (something unheard of before). In particular, to motherboard makers that add them to the latest NVIDIA solutions. And Californian company seems to cease its SoundStorm initiative by not implementing additional hardware audio features and thus making motherboard manufacturers use chips from Creative. Nevertheless, there´s a lot of rumours in the Web circulating around improved discrete SoundStorm 2 that might become a base for standalone soundcards. It´s hard to tell if these will compete with Creative´s solutions, but considering the latest trend (Creative searching for new income sources) and NVIDIA´s huge potential...

ECS releases KN1 Extreme boards for Athlon64 (S939 and S754) processors

ECS announced several nForce4-based motherboards for Athlon64 Socket 754 and Socket 939 processors. KN1 Extreme is a high-performance board that supports PCI-E, features 3Gbps SATA and RAID.

KN1 Extreme:



CPU support Socket 939 AMD Athlon 64/Athlon 64 FX
Chipset NVIDIA nForce4 Ultra
Memory DDR, 2-channel DDR400/333/266/200, up to 4 GB
Expansion slots 1 x PCI Express x16, 2 x PCI Express x1, 3 x PCI
Controllers 4 x Ultra DMA133/100/66
4 x Serial ATA2 (SiS® 180)
2 x Ultra DMA133/100/66
2 x Serial ATA
RAID0, RAID1, RAID 0+1
Audio 6-channel Realtek ALC655, (AC´97 2.3)
IEEE1394a 2 x TI TSB43AB22A
Networking Realtek 8100C 10/100 Mbps Fast Ethernet
Marvell 88E1111 Giga LAN PHY
Form-factor ATX, 305 x 244 mm

Features also include 802.11g, 10 x USB ports. The board is bundled with NVIDIA nTune FSB adjusting utility.

KN1 Extreme nForce4-A939 is already available for sale, while the Socket 754 variant is to arrive later in December.

Broadcom BCM5751: Gigabit Ethernet to be featured in VIA K8T890 by default

VIA and Broadcom officially announced the integration of Gigabit Ethernet adapters into VIA K8T890 chipset.

Of course, Gigabit Ethernet is not a total novelty for such motherboards (i.e. Gigabyte GA-K8VT890-9), but this agreement states that K8T890 chipsets will now have Broadcom BCM5751 chip by default.

Through PCI Express x1, Broadcom BCM5751 is claimed to provide 250 MB/s bandwidth. It also supports ASF (Alerting Standards Forum) 2.0.

Nemesis: a new series of "desktop armour" from NZXT

NZXT updated its Nemesis PC case series with new models. Below is the top one — Nemesis Elite Edition:


Besides the eccentric appearance, the model offers extended features. First of all, it´s the small info display on top that shows in-case temperature and fan speeds as well as date and time. The climat inside the case is supported by three 1800 rpm 120 mm fans with LED lights, 1 mm aluminium walls and temperature sensors. Besides, modders will like transparent wall with a fan and knight-style decorations along with lots of LED lights (seven colors available):


Under a kind of visor there are 5.25" and 3.5" bays. The front panel also features headphones, mic, USB 2.0, IEEE1394 ports. Optionally the cases are bundled with 400W PSUs. Case colors are ash gray or black.

The Nemesis model is a simpler variant of Nemesis Elite Edition. It´s made of 0.8mm steel and doesn´t have control and monitoring unit. Instead, the color range includes 5 colors.

Model Nemesis Elite Edition Nemesis
Type MID TOWER
Size 205 x 436 x 450 mm 200 x 430 x 451 mm
Material 1 mm aluminium 0.8 mm steel
Weight 6.5 kg
Form-factors supported ATX, Mini ATX Micro ATX, Baby AT
PSU Optional 400W 400W
Fans 3 x 120 mm BLUE LED FAN 1 x 120 mm BLUE LED FAN, 1 x 120 mm, (+ 1 x 120 mm optional)
External bays 1 x 5.25", 2 x 3.5" 1 x 5.25", 1 x 3.5"
Internal bays 9 x HDD, 3 x 5.25" 10 x HDD, 4 x 5.25"
Front panel I/O Headphones, mic, USB 2.0, IEEE1394
Price €139 €89
